 WEDNESDAY SEPTEMBER 23   
Empire Premiere Watch Party
8–10 at The MOCHA Center, 1092 Main St.

Watch the Season 2 premiere of Fox’s hit show Empire, about a terminally ill music mogul looking to pass his empire down to one of his sons — and one of his sons happens to be gay. Doors open at 8 p.m. with light refreshments. Show starts at 9 p.m. Watch parties all season long.


 THURSDAY SEPTEMBER 24 
Soundwave with Babik and The Albrights
8PM at Kleinhans Music Hall, 3 Symphony Cir.

Join The Albrights in a career benchmark performance with the Buffalo Philharmonic Orchestra, a symphonic mash-up of indie rock, cutting-edge classical and Gypsy jazz with favorites like “Zion Man” and “Soundwave.” Students, $10; general admission, $20; includes a free beverage and slice of pizza.


 SATURDAY SEPTEMBER 26 
Queen City Softball League Banquet
6–9PM at Troop I’s Hamlin House, 432 Franklin St.

The league’s 23rd season has come to a close; now it’s time for the party. Full dinner buffet, three hours of open bar with a DJ and dancing. Tickets: Players, $25; guests, $35. Purchase discounted presale tickets at queencitysoftball.com.


 SATURDAY SEPTEMBER 26 
The Main Drag with The Fem Follies
8PM at The Grange Theater, 22 Main St., Hamburg

A classy drag cabaret in suburbia, where you enjoy the ambiance of the theater and you don’t have to stay up late. Robitka2Kay along with Melody Michaels, Kelly Valasquez-Lord and Chevon Davis, every last Saturday of the theater’s 2015/2016 season. Tickets, $10.
